Fortnite Patch 8.11 Notes: Flint-Knock Pistol, Impulse Grenade, One Shot LTM, More

The Flint-Knock Pistol and One Shot LTM are here.

Comments

Fortnite's updates keep on coming, and now we've got yet another patch to keep us entertained in our battle royale excursions. Version 8.11 is live now on PS4, Xbox One, PC, Nintendo Switch, and mobile, bringing with it a new weapon and another limited-time mode. Here's a breakdown of what awaits you, besides the new Week 4 challenges.

The new weapon is named the Flint-Knock Pistol, and it looks powerful. Developer Epic Games says the gun does up to 90 damage at close range, but it suffers from "significant damage falloff" at range and needs to be reloaded after every shot--a process that takes three seconds. The Flint-Knock Pistol uses Heavy Ammo and can be found in floor loot in Common and Uncommon rarities.

Notably, the gun causes a knockback effect to the person firing it. Provided the enemy is close enough, it will also knock them back, too, although the exact distance is dictated by how close the two of you are to one another. The knockback for the shooter might be desirable in some cases, but if you want to avoid it, you can crouch before firing--this prevents any knockback.

One Shot is Fortnite's latest LTM, meanwhile. This mode enables low gravity and restricts player health to just 50. Sniper Rifles and Hunting Rifles are the only weapons available, while Bandages are your only help if things go wrong.

Elsewhere, the Impulse Grenade has been unvaulted and seen its strength against vehicles increased by 344%. In fact, all explosive weapons have had their impulse strength against vehicles increased by 233%. Finally, The Baller's spawn rate has been halved and the Scoped Assault Rifle's base damage has increased to 27/26 from 24/23.

With this patch now out, as noted above, Week 4 challenges are now available in Battle Royale. One of these was initially bugged, preventing players from completing it, but that issue should now be ironed out. You won't find any especially challenging or complex challenges this week; your most difficult task might simply be tracking down The Baller, the recently added vehicle.

Fortnite: Battle Royale Update 8.11 Patch Notes

Weapons And Items

  • Flint-Knock Pistol
    • Available in Common and Uncommon Rarities.
    • Found from Floor Loot.
    • Knocks back the shooter. Can also knock back the target if they’re close enough.
      • The closer you are to the target, the farther they get knocked away.
      • The shooter can crouch to prevent the knockback.
    • Close range damage: 86/90
      • Significant damage falloff.
    • Must reload after each shot.
      • 3 second reload time.
    • Uses Heavy Ammo.
  • Unvaulted the Impulse Grenade
    • Impulse strength against vehicles has been increased by 344%
  • Increased the impulse strength of explosive weapons against vehicles by 233%
  • Scoped Assault Rifle
    • Increased base damage from 24/23 to 27/26
  • Reduced the spawn rate of the Baller from 100% to 50%

Limited-Time Mode: One Shot

Summary

Low Gravity. Every player has 50 health. Snipers are the only weapon and Bandages are the only healing item. Jump high and aim well!

Mode Details

  • Gravity is set lower than normal.
  • The Storm wait time has been greatly reduced in all phases of the game.
  • The only weapons in this mode are Hunting Rifles and Sniper Rifles.
  • Semi-Auto Snipers and Bounce Pads have been removed from the Vault in this mode.
  • Players will spawn with 50 health, and can only heal if they find Bandages.

Events

  • Tournament Update: Gauntlet Solo Test Event & Gauntlet Duo Test Event
    • Added two additional extended sessions, which will run 24 hours a day.
      • 3/19/2019 00:00 UTC until 3/23/2019 00:00 UTC
      • 3/23/2019 00:00 UTC until 3/26/2019 00:00 UTC
  • New Tournament: Blackheart Cup (March 23rd & 24th) [$100,000 in Cash Prizes!]
    • Participation in this event requires players to have placed in the Top 3% (global) of any Gauntlet Test Event session prior to the start of the tournament.
    • The prize pool will be distributed across all server regions, with official rules and details released later this week.
    • Format:
      • March 23rd - Round One: All Eligible Players
      • March 24th - Round Two: Top 3000 Players from Round One
  • Participating in tournaments and the Gauntlet Test now requires a minimum account level of 15. The requirement was previously at level 10.
